Taxonomic Classification
| Rank | Aratathomas's Yellow-shouldered Bat | River Thread-moss |
|---|---|---|
| Kingdom | Animalia (Animals) | Plantae (Plants) |
| Phylum | Chordata (Chordates) | Bryophyta |
| Class | Mammalia (Mammals) | Bryopsida (Bryopsida) |
| Order | Chiroptera (Bats) | Bryales (Bryales) |
| Family | Phyllostomidae | Bryaceae |
| Genus | Sturnira | Bryum |
| Species | Sturnira aratathomasi | Bryum riparium |
